Fake ATM doesn't last long at hacker meet

 

In a prize display of stupidity a criminal group of scammers left a fake ATM machine at host hotel for Defcon. Unsuprisingly the security professionsls quickly identified the fake and reported it to authorities.

 

As the conference was kicking off a few days ago, attendees noticed that at ATM placed in the Riviera Hotel, which plays host to the annual event, didn't quite look right, according to a senior conference organizer who identified himself only as Priest. "They looked at the screen where there would normally be a camera," he said. "It was a little bit too dark, so someone shined a flashlight in there and there was a PC."
